Camm, thanks for the info about Wine & Maxima.
I set up the binfmt stuff to recognize .exe files and it
seems to work as intended (.exe is indeed executed
via Wine) but I get the same error about msys.
I don't understand the logic of detect_wine -- I don't
see how it could succeed. Maybe you can help me
understand it.
I tried to execute just GCL itself by installing GCL 2.6.9
ANSI from the download page for the GCL project.
The installer runs OK (some warnings) but saved_ansi_gcl.exe
fails with the same error which originates in detect_wine.
Here's how it reads when I try to execute saved_ansi_gcl.exe:
Can't recognize 'c:/_cvs/gcl/lib/gcl-2.6.9/unixport/msys /tmp/ out8
tmp8 log8' as an internal or external command, or batch script.
I see that the installer installed msys.exe in the folder
GCL-2.6.9-ANSI/unixport, but saved_ansi_gcl.exe tries
to execute c:/_cvs/gcl/lib/gcl-2.6.9/unixport/msys instead.
Looks like the immediate problem is that *SYSTEM-DIRECTORY*
is not assigned a local path name but gets a hardcoded value
(something set at build time, I guess) instead.
Reading o/main.c, I see that GCL will accept a command
line argument for *SYSTEM-DIRECTORY* if initflag == 0,
which is not the case for saved images but is for raw images,
according to a comment in main.c.
So ... I can get a little farther by executing raw_ansi_gcl.exe.
wine ./drive_c/ProgramFiles/GCL-2.6.9-ANSI/unixport/raw_ansi_gcl.exe
`pwd`/drive_c/ProgramFiles/GCL-2.6.9-ANSI/unixport/
GCL (GNU Common Lisp) April 1994 131071 pages
Building symbol table for
Z:/home/robert/.wine/drive_c/ProgramFiles/GCL-2.6.9-ANSI/unixport/raw_ansi_gcl.exe
..
loading
/home/robert/.wine/drive_c/ProgramFiles/GCL-2.6.9-ANSI/unixport/../lsp/gcl_export.lsp
Then it just sits there until I hit ctrl-C.
strace shows that it seems to be repeatedly reading from
z:/tmp/out8 which has the content
ar x
/home/robert/.wine/drive_c/ProgramFiles/GCL-2.6.9-ANSI/unixport/libansi_gcl.a
gcl_defmacro.o
I guess this is related to scheme implemented by msys --
not sure how this is supposed to play out.
